[0002] The present disclosure relates to the field of Internet technology, and in particular to information return methods, devices, electronic devices, computer storage media and products. [Background technology]
[0003] With the continuous development of Internet technology, when a user sees information such as a comment or question using a client to comment or reply to multimedia content, the user often wants to reply to this information. Currently, the user can reply to this information after the information is displayed in the comment area of the playback interface of the multimedia content.
[0004] However, the replying methods of the prior art are not uniform and flexible, which affects the replying interest of users. Summary of the Invention
[0005] To solve the above technical problems, or at least partially solve the above technical problems, the present disclosure provides information return methods, devices, electronic devices, computer storage media and products.
[0006] According to a first aspect, the present disclosure provides an information return method, the information return method comprising: After the target information, which is a comment or reply to the target multimedia content, is favorited, displaying the target information on the favorite page in response to a viewing command for the target information; receiving a reply instruction for the target information; and returning the target information in response to the reply instruction.
[0007] According to the method of the first aspect, after the target information has been favorited, the client can display the target information on the favorite page in response to a viewing command for the target information. After receiving a reply command for the target information, the client can reply to the target information. This allows the information after being favorited to be used to realize a re-reply to the information, which is advantageous in reducing the complexity of user operations and enriching the reply method channels, and can also help increase the interest of users in replying to information and the probability that users will create and publish videos.

[0040] Illustratively, the present disclosure provides an information reply method, device, electronic device, computer storage medium, and computer program product, which, after target information is favorited, displays the target information on the favorite page, and a new entry for replying to the target information can be added to the favorite page, making it easier to realize replying to the target information, eliminating the need to search for the target information in the comment area of the playback interface of the target multimedia content and replying the target information, which reduces the complexity of user operations, is beneficial to enriching the reply method channels, and increases the interest of users in replying to the target information.
[0041] Here, the target information is a comment or reply to the target multimedia content. The present disclosure does not limit the specific implementation manner of the target information. In some embodiments, the target information may include comment information and / or question information of the target multimedia content.
[0042] Here, the format of returning the target information referred to in the present disclosure may include a text format and a multimedia content format. The text format may be understood as returning the target information using, for example, text, symbols, numbers, alphabets, images, videos, etc. The multimedia content format may be understood as returning the target information using multimedia content, or returning the target information using multimedia content and reply text. The reply text may be understood as returning the target information using, for example, text, symbols, numbers, alphabets, etc.
